Ukraine’s IT Market: Exports, Local Sales and Economic Impact

Ukraine's IT Market: Exports, Local Sales and Economic Impact

Publication date:

  • 19.02.2025

Publication from:

IT Ukraine

Maria Shevchuk, Executive Director of the IT Ukraine Association, for DOU:

  • shared her thoughts on what currently has the most impact on business operations; 
  • explained which factors could help IT exports grow; 
  • laid the argument for why the success of Ukraine’s tech industry should not be measured solely by IT export figures.
 

To accurately assess data on IT exports, it is important to pay attention to how it is collected. In export and import reporting, companies list the export service code and the export amount, which forms the basis for analysis. For example, if a hardware company exports only its equipment abroad, the report will likely classify this as the export of equipment (products), not IT. However, if the company also provided software development services abroad, it would be classified as the export of services.

 

Overall, the size of the IT market is not limited to exports. It is crucial to consider sales on the local market, both of IT products and services, which generate significant revenue domestically. For example, well-known digital platforms contribute a considerable share to GDP, yet they do not appear in export statistics, even though they have a significant impact on the economy. Therefore, to properly assess the development of the tech industry, it is necessary to account for not only exports but also other factors, such as the penetration of IT into various sectors of the economy, which significantly contributes to overall economic growth.
